tbi trouble
I have an 87 chevy R-10. 350-350 combo. Engine has tbi on it. I have recently been experiencing some trouble with the engine running properly. It runs fine when the motor is cold but when the motor gets hot it wont want to idle in gear. It will slow down and want to die unless i brake torque it(which isnt the safest thing to do). I have replaced the idle air motor and the fuel filter is fairly new. I have also tested the throttle position sensor and it tests good and I have tested for vacuum and all is well there. Any idea's would be greatly appreciated.

it's a pita to do, but check your fuel pressure. tbi's will actually run with less than 1 psi, but require at least 9psi to run right. 13- 14 lbs to run really good. had the same problem with mine.
